The Chamber of Commerce in Chiriqui is calling for participation in a business conference to be held from August 23 to 25 at the International Fair of David.
From a statement issued by the Camchi:
The fourth version of the Business Conference run by the Chamber of Commerce, Industries and Agriculture of Chiriqui from August 23 to 25 2016 in the city of David, Chiriqui province, will be the perfect opportunity for domestic producers and companies from the various sectors in the formal economy to sell or buy certified products and services from buyers from Costa Rica, Guatemala, Uruguay, Mexico, Ecuador, Paraguay, Bolivia, China and El Salvador.

Seven German companies are visiting the country to explore opportunities in sectors related to hydraulic engineering, energy, transportation, agricultural production and health.
A delegation of 10 representatives from seven German businesses will be staying for a week in the country to meet with various business chambers and look for investment opportunities in different sectors, including the project of the Grand Canal.

From March 15th to 18th a group of 24 coffee importers will be visiting the country to explore business opportunities.
The Embassy of the Republic of China (Taiwan) in El Salvador together will the Salvadoran Coffee Council will be receiving 24 coffee importers, seeking business opportunities with Salvadoran sector companies that have organic, special and brand certificate coffee.

From 6 to 7 May companies and investors in the sector will be in in San José taking part in business meetings and conferences relevant to franchises in the region.
The second edition of the American Franchise Summit will be held at the Hotel Park Inn, Costa Rica and will involve seven international speakers. The event will last two days and is aimed at 150 franchisees and franchisors investors with the aim of promoting business appointments.

A new trade mission to Germany involving local companies is being coordinated by the German-Nicaraguan Business Club and in September companies from the European country will arrive in Nicaragua.
The German government's initiative intends to further strengthen business and trade relations between the two countries. In 2013 Germany was the fourth largest international purchaser of Nicaraguan products.

During the "V Migrant Encounter 2012", Guatemalan businessmen living in the United States will meet with local business representatives.
The meeting is part of the government's strategy to increase investment levels in Guatemala, and especially by having some of the billions of dollars that are sent by Guatemalans living abroad invested in productive enterprises.
Between 22 and 29 of October Guatemalan businessmen will be exploring business opportunities in various sectors of the Italian economy.
During the trade mission, organized by the Italian-Guatemalan Chamber of Commerce and Industry and Agexport, deals are expected to be struck worth around $1 million.
Siglo21.com.quoted the director of the Guatemalan Association of Exporters (Agexport), Luis Godoy, who said, "Italy has been an accessible business partner to Guatemala for several years, giving us the opportunity to export products such as coffee, drinks and spirits, bananas, apparel, wood products and natural rubber.
